Apply pressure, heat, apply more pressure, heat more, if the power head doesn't pop then shake the long studs with an air chisel (you can replace these 4 later). Repeat. If you have some old 9/16" wrenches and a grinder . . . you can trim some meat off the sides and get a full turn on the nuts.
